George Sawicki

Chief Operating Officer at KPS - (Kellman Pharmaceutical Services)

George’s career spans 25 years within the pharmaceutical industry.

He joined KPS in 2014 as Vice President of Business Operations & Alliances accountable for growing the client portfolio within KPS. In 2018, he was appointed to Chief Operating Officer of KPS to expand the operational infrastructure and client base within KPS to support its growth and quality of Services delivered. Prior to joining KPS, George was Global Head of R&D Procurement for Teva Pharmaceuticals and Cephalon, Inc. (prior to Teva’s acquisition of Cephalon in 2011). He provided sourcing and procurement strategies for Teva’s R&D organization on the Branded Products side for all clinical categories. In addition, he was accountable for all Strategic Relationship Management (SRM) execution and oversight with Teva’s 3rd party suppliers across R&D.

George was Director of Contracts at ReSearch Pharmaceutical Services, accountable for all Sponsor contracting and study site negotiations worldwide from 2002-2007. He organized and was accountable for the first centralized outsourcing function within Clinical Research for Pfizer’s Global R&D division in Groton, Connecticut.

George began his career at Covance, Inc., a global CRO, as its Director of Finance.

George earned his B.S. in Marketing and Management from West Chester University. He has spoken at numerous pharmaceutical industry conferences over the years and has been instrumental in driving value and cost savings for the pharmaceutical companies that he has worked for through the strategic use of clinical outsourcing providers.
